Web22 jul. 2024 · Prepare the skin around your nails with cuticle oil, cuticle cream, vaseline, or a similar moisturizer. Then, with a buffer, buff off the top coat of your pedicure. This will allow the acetone in the next step to adequately penetrate your gel polish. Apply a 100% acetone soaked cotton ball or pad to each toe nail.
